In 2017, 14 February at the University of world economy and diplomacy, was celebrated as the date of birth of such great poets as Alisher Navoi and Zahiriddin Babur, in connection with which was timed festive programme on the theme of “Heritage and creativity of Alisher Navoi and Zahiriddin Bobur - alive forever”. The event was attended by contemporary novelist and writer, translator, winner of the medal Shuhrat - Ulugbek Hamdam, as well as popular artists of the Uzbek national drama theatre, Tolibjon Muminov, Tahir Saidov, Gulnora Jumaniyazova and others, as well as faculty and staff of the University.

The meeting with his welcoming speech was opened by the rector A. Djumanov. Then the artists of the national theatre production of “Navoi and Ghouli”, and also read the works of great poets.

In his speech, Ulugbek Hamdam spoke about the invaluable legacy of the poets read excerpts from their work, and the role of philosophical and moral studies thinkers. Then the students asked interesting questions on the above topic and the guests answered them.

Rector A. Djumanov thanked the guests and presented them with commemorative gifts.
